Output ec67133be9a695f5a233be5b5bc348136fc161c87f73107f2e030b3ca7a44302:46

value
309358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ed9e603688be37b695e1c64a2f58dc2950befe5 OP_EQUAL
address
34W9E9igGbSD4vjNPMgN5QNsHdbUXXf2eB
transaction
ec67133be9a695f5a233be5b5bc348136fc161c87f73107f2e030b3ca7a44302
spent
true